In this episode, we break down how to find and sell low competition digital products in 2026 — without getting stuck in saturated markets like generic planners, ebooks, and templates.

You’ll learn how successful creators are shifting toward micro-niche digital products that solve specific problems for specific audiences.

We explore:

  • What “low competition” really means in today’s digital market
  • High-potential product ideas for 2026 (AI prompts, Notion systems, micro-reports, mini courses, and more)
  • How to validate ideas before building anything
  • Common mistakes that stop beginners from making sales
  • Tools and strategies to find winning digital product opportunities

If you want to start or scale a digital product business in the USA or Australia markets, this episode will help you think differently — and more profitably.
